About the MTC

At the Manufacturing Technology Centre (MTC), we’re shaping the future of UK manufacturing. As a world-renowned research and development organisation, we bridge the gap between academia and industry, helping manufacturers of all sizes innovate and thrive.

With cutting-edge facilities in Coventry, Liverpool, and Oxford, and as part of the High Value Manufacturing Catapult, we work across sectors including aerospace, automotive, construction, electronics, and defence. Our collaborative, forward-thinking environment is home to some of the brightest minds in engineering.

The Role: Employee Relations Lead

We’re looking for a strategic and empathetic Employee Relations Lead to champion a positive, productive, and legally compliant workplace culture. Reporting to the Head of People Experience, you’ll play a key role in shaping our employee relations strategy and supporting our people managers.

Key Responsibilities
  • Lead and manage employee relations cases (grievances, disciplinary, performance, etc.)
  • Develop and implement ER strategies and policies aligned with employment law and MTC values
  • Provide expert advice on legal compliance and employment law updates
  • Coach and train managers to foster positive team dynamics
  • Analyse data to identify trends and inform strategic decisions
  • Collaborate with internal and external stakeholders, including legal professionals
  • Oversee policy effectiveness and manage Occupational Health services
What We’re Looking For
  • Strong knowledge of employment law and HR practices
  • Excellent leadership, communication, and conflict resolution skills
  • Proven ability to build relationships and influence stakeholders
  • Analytical mindset with experience interpreting data and trends
